Baymont by Wyndham Greenfield

Open
2270 N State St
Greenfield, IN 46140
Owner verified
See a problem?

You might also like

United StatesIndianaGreenfieldBaymont by Wyndham Greenfield

Partial Data by Infogroup (c) 2025. All rights reserved.